The United States House of Representatives Committee on Oversight and Government Reform has initiated an investigation into claims that major players in the cryptocurrency industry have had their bank accounts closed. The committee’s objective is to ensure that American citizens can participate in U.S. markets without fear of negative consequences from financial institutions or regulators.
Background of the Allegations
In a letter sent to Uniswap Labs CEO Hayden Adams, Marc Andreessen of Andreessen Horowitz, Brian Armstrong of Coinbase, David Marcus from Lightspark, Kraken CEO Dave Ripley, and Kristin Smith of the Blockchain Association, the committee expressed its determination to protect citizens’ access to the financial system.
Views of Industry Leaders
Marc Andreessen mentioned in a 2024 interview that over 30 founders have had their accounts closed by banks due to political targeting over the past four years.
